Top 5 Reference Apps Performance in Russia Q2 2024
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 reference apps in Russia for Q2 2024,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the second quarter of 2024, the top 5 reference apps in Russia demonstrated varied performance metrics on both iOS and Android platforms. Below is a detailed look at their we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
Билеты ПДД 2024 экзамен ГАИ РФ from Amayama Auto LLC saw stable weekly downloads, fluctuating between approximately 63K to 90K. The app started the quarter with 90K downloads and ended with 74K. Weekly active users ranged from 1.2M to 1.3M, peaking at 1.3M at the start and maintaining a similar level by the end of the quarter.
Yandex Translate, published by Direct Cursus Computer Systems Trading, experienced a decline in weekly downloads from 69K to 55K. Active users also showed a downward trend, starting at 3.4M and ending at 2.7M. Despite the decline, the app maintained substantial engagement throughout the quarter.
Checkmark: Boost Your Savings by Mukad Patel, a newcomer released in mid-June 2024, quickly gained traction. Downloads surged from 23K in its debut week to 77K by the end of the quarter. Although active users data was not available, the rapid increase in downloads indicates strong initial interest.
Номерограм – проверка авто from Авто Ассист showed steady weekly downloads, averaging around 27K to 37K. The app's weekly revenue varied, peaking at $2.8K in mid-June. Active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 254K and 279K.
Google Translate by Google maintained consistent weekly downloads, starting at 39K and closing at 27K. Active users showed a slight decline from 4.3M to 3.6M over the quarter, indicating sustained but slightly decreasing usage.
